To whom it may concern,
As of the 21st, binutils uses long section names with DJGPP. This may be why Andris 
was having problems with C++ exceptions, if it happened on or after the 21st. This 
means some changes need to be made to djgpp.djl because we can no longer count on 
section names being truncated to 8 characters. Since we're using djgpp.djl and not 
the linker scripts included in Binutils, the following changes should be made to 
djgpp.djl:

*** djgpp.djm	Sun Jul 12 22:53:46 1998
--- djgpp.djl	Wed Jul 28 15:15:30 1999
*************** SECTIONS
*** 4,9 ****
--- 4,11 ----
  {
    .text  0x1000+SIZEOF_HEADERS : {
      *(.text)
+     *(.gnu.linkonce.t*)
+     *(.gnu.linkonce.r*)
      etext  =  . ; _etext = .;
      . = ALIGN(0x200);
    }
*************** SECTIONS
*** 15,23 ****
      *(.dtor)
      djgpp_last_dtor = . ;
      *(.data)
!     *(.gcc_exc)
      ___EH_FRAME_BEGIN__ = . ;
!     *(.eh_fram)
      ___EH_FRAME_END__ = . ;
      LONG(0)
       edata  =  . ; _edata = .;
--- 17,26 ----
      *(.dtor)
      djgpp_last_dtor = . ;
      *(.data)
!     *(.gnu.linkonce.d*)
!     *(.gcc_exc*)
      ___EH_FRAME_BEGIN__ = . ;
!     *(.eh_fram*)
      ___EH_FRAME_END__ = . ;
      LONG(0)
       edata  =  . ; _edata = .;
